Output 3ec8605281a3764d1498bca2359caf466710e302266daeb9e087176cd51d45d3:31

value
404259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1691870e51329d91882336d6d92c360fe618ebef OP_EQUAL
address
33kM8CLeGe8WRJaKZ6BGGWFuE1uawR9433
transaction
3ec8605281a3764d1498bca2359caf466710e302266daeb9e087176cd51d45d3
confirmations
321525
spent
true